Anthem Bronze Pathway 10150 ($0 Virtual PCP + $0 Select Drugs + Incentives) is a 2026 Bronze EPO health insurance plan from Anthem Blue Cross and Blue Shield, sold on the ACA Marketplace in Missouri under plan ID 32753MO0980022. The monthly premium starts at $406 before subsidies, based on a 40-year-old in the plan's lowest-cost rating area. The individual medical deductible is $10,150 ($20,300 for a family), and the individual out-of-pocket maximum is $10,150 ($20,300 for a family). After the deductible, coinsurance is 0% for covered in-network care. The plan is HSA-eligible, so it can be paired with a Health Savings Account.

💡 What this means:
With a $10,150 deductible, you pay 100% of costs until you've spent that much. After that, you pay 0% (coinsurance) until you hit $10,150 total. Then insurance covers everything else for the year.

Frequently asked questions about Anthem Bronze Pathway 10150 ($0 Virtual PCP + $0 Select Drugs + Incentives)
How much does Anthem Bronze Pathway 10150 ($0 Virtual PCP + $0 Select Drugs + Incentives) cost per month?
Anthem Bronze Pathway 10150 ($0 Virtual PCP + $0 Select Drugs + Incentives) from Anthem Blue Cross and Blue Shield starts at $406 per month before any subsidy in Missouri. Most Marketplace enrollees qualify for a premium tax credit that lowers what they actually pay — estimate your subsidy to see your net premium.
What is the deductible for Anthem Bronze Pathway 10150 ($0 Virtual PCP + $0 Select Drugs + Incentives)?
The individual medical deductible is $10,150, and the family deductible is $20,300. You pay for covered care out of pocket until you meet the deductible, after which the plan shares costs with you.
What is the out-of-pocket maximum for Anthem Bronze Pathway 10150 ($0 Virtual PCP + $0 Select Drugs + Incentives)?
The most you would pay in a year for covered in-network care is $10,150 for an individual and $20,300 for a family. Once you reach it, the plan pays 100% of covered services for the rest of the year.
Is Anthem Bronze Pathway 10150 ($0 Virtual PCP + $0 Select Drugs + Incentives) HSA-eligible?
Yes. Anthem Bronze Pathway 10150 ($0 Virtual PCP + $0 Select Drugs + Incentives) is a qualified high-deductible health plan, so you can pair it with a Health Savings Account (HSA) and pay for eligible medical expenses with pre-tax dollars.
What type of network does Anthem Bronze Pathway 10150 ($0 Virtual PCP + $0 Select Drugs + Incentives) use?
Anthem Bronze Pathway 10150 ($0 Virtual PCP + $0 Select Drugs + Incentives) is a EPO plan. EPO plans cover in-network care only (except emergencies) and usually do not require referrals to see specialists.
